Understanding Terminal Illness Cover: A Comprehensive Guide

Facing a terminal illness diagnosis can be one of the most difficult and challenging experiences one can endure. The emotional, physical, and financial burdens that come with such a diagnosis can be overwhelming for anyone involved. That is where terminal illness cover comes in to provide some relief and peace of mind during these trying times.

terminal illness cover is a type of insurance that provides a lump sum payment if the policyholder is diagnosed with a terminal illness that is expected to lead to death within a specified period, usually 12 months. This payout can help alleviate financial burdens such as medical bills, ongoing care costs, and other expenses that may arise during this critical time.

There are several key points to consider when looking into terminal illness cover. Understanding the terms and conditions of the policy is crucial to ensure you are adequately protected. Here are some important aspects to keep in mind:

1. Definition of Terminal Illness: Different insurance providers may have varying definitions of what constitutes a terminal illness. It is essential to know the specific criteria that need to be met for a payout to be triggered. Typically, it involves a prognosis from a medical professional that the policyholder has a life expectancy of 12 months or less.

2. Waiting Period: Some policies may have a waiting period before the terminal illness cover comes into effect. This is important to consider when choosing a policy, as you want to make sure you are covered as soon as possible after a diagnosis.

3. Coverage Amount: The lump sum payment provided by terminal illness cover can vary depending on the policy and the premiums paid. It is crucial to assess your financial needs and choose a coverage amount that will adequately support you and your family during this difficult time.

4. Premiums and Payment Terms: The cost of terminal illness cover will depend on various factors, such as age, health status, and coverage amount. It is essential to understand the premium amounts and payment terms to ensure you can afford the policy in the long run.

5. Exclusions and Limitations: Like any insurance policy, terminal illness cover may have exclusions and limitations. It is important to read the fine print and understand what is not covered under the policy to avoid any surprises when making a claim.

6. Additional Benefits: Some terminal illness cover policies may come with additional benefits, such as access to medical professionals or support services. These can be valuable resources during a challenging time and should be considered when choosing a policy.
